About the role

AECOM is actively seeking a Construction Project Manager IV – Water Transmission Infrastructure for AECOM's Construction Engineering & Inspection (CEI) services in Indiana.

Responsibilities

  • Responsible for the overall management administration of a project and assists in establishing project specific objectives and policies.
  • Provides management and guidance to subordinate managers and inspectors, enforces company, client, and project policies, and a primary liaison between AECOM and client interface.
  • Oversees and ensures all facets of the project are constructed in accordance with design, budget and schedule through subordinate supervisors and inspectors.
  • Ensures inspection teams are adequately performing daily field inspections and maintaining inspection records.
  • Responsible for administering the project from the pre-construction budgeting/schedule stage through procurement, shop drawing/coordination development, construction, space turnover and contract closeout.
  • Responsible for ensuring inspection teams are monitoring conformance to quality, performance, specifications, and/or code requirements.
  • Build relationships with current and potential clients and pursue business development activities for construction management-related projects.
  • Consult with Contractor’s Superintendent on work progress and maintenance issues; review equipment utilization data and time/cost estimates.
  • Review drawings, specifications and contract requirements to understand/prepare for inspection, and to ensure good construction practices, clarity, and consistency.
  • Identify and report potential coordination, quality, safety, and environmental issues.
  • Perform a variety of calculations and computations.
  • Maintain thorough and accurate inspection records of construction to document compliance with contract requirements.
  • Review, prepare and process various reports associated with construction management duties: shop drawing submittals, change orders, field changes, RFI’s, clarifications, pay estimates, force account documents, project diary, daily work reports, weekly and monthly progress reports, punch lists, project closeout.
  • Monitor construction records to ensure contractors comply with federal requirements regarding Equal Employment Opportunity, on-the-job training program, the Historically Underutilized Business and the Disadvantaged Business Enterprise programs.
  • Lead and assist in project administration and weekly/monthly progress meetings with the Project Manager and Contractor.
  • Assist in review and reconciliation of construction schedules.
  • Assist in verification of completion of project milestones, punch lists, and contract closeout documents.
  • Observe quality assurance testing and review test results for conformance with contract requirements.
  • Perform daily inspections, as required, and record daily diary for each project assigned.
  • Perform field measurements of pay items and verify quantities for Contractor’s monthly pay estimate.
  • Verify “As Built” information is recorded and accurate.
  • Perform other responsibilities as assigned.
